Capturing genuine family moments in photography requires a blend of spontaneity and technique. Tip 1: Always be prepared. Keep your camera handy, whether it's a DSLR, smartphone, or even a compact camera. Tip 2: Focus on candid shots rather than posed pictures. Some of the most treasured memories arise when families are simply enjoying each other's company. Tip 3: Encourage interaction between family members to elicit authentic expressions and laughter. Tip 4: Utilize natural light, as it creates a warm and soft ambiance that enhances the emotional tone of your photos. Planning a fun family photoshoot can be an exciting yet challenging experience. To ensure that your session is enjoyable and yields beautiful photos, start by choosing the right location. Consider natural settings like parks or beaches, which provide stunning backdrops. Don't forget to think about timing—golden hour (shortly after sunrise or before sunset) is a fantastic time for photography due to its soft, warm light. Next, prepare your family by planning outfits that reflect your family's personalities while ensuring cohesion. Avoid busy patterns and opt for a color palette that compliments the surroundings. It's also wise to include meaningful props or activities that represent your family's unique interests.
